The Ultimate Guide to Secondary Glazing Maintenance: Preservation and Performance
Secondary glazing is commonly related to as one of the most effective ways to enhance the thermal effectiveness and acoustic insulation of a home, especially in heritage or noted structures where replacing original windows is not an alternative. By adding a second internal pane of glass, homeowners can significantly decrease heat loss-- by up to 65%-- and supply an effective barrier versus external sound.

Nevertheless, like any high-performance architectural function, secondary glazing requires routine attention to ensure it continues to operate efficiently. Neglecting upkeep can result in problems such as stiff operation, jeopardized seals, or the accumulation of condensation between the panes. This guide offers a thorough summary of how to keep secondary glazing systems to guarantee long-term toughness and visual appeal.
Comprehending the Components
To keep secondary glazing efficiently, one must initially comprehend the components that make up the system. The majority of systems include an aluminum or uPVC frame, glass panes (which may be toughened or acoustic), brush seals, rubber gaskets, and various hardware such as handles, hinges, or moving tracks.
Each of these components needs a different method to care. Frames require cleaning to prevent pitting, seals require inspection to guarantee they remain airtight, and moving parts need lubrication to prevent wear and tear.
Routine Cleaning Procedures
Cleanliness is the structure of window maintenance. Dust and pollutants can build up not only on the glass but also within the tracks and on the seals, which can ultimately cause mechanical failure.
Glass Maintenance
For the glass itself, a moderate option of soapy water or a premium, non-abrasive glass cleaner is generally sufficient. It is essential to utilize soft, lint-free microfiber fabrics. Utilizing abrasive sponges or harsh chemicals can scratch the surface area of the glass or damage specialized coatings, such as Low-E (Low Emissivity) layers.
Frame Maintenance
Whether the secondary glazing is housed in aluminum or uPVC, cleaning the frames is important. Gradually, climatic contaminants can settle on the frames.
- Aluminum Frames: These must be cleaned down with a soft fabric and a neutral detergent. Avoid using solvent-based cleaners, as these can damage the powder-coated surface.
- Timber Subframes: If the unit is mounted on a wood subframe, the wood must be inspected for signs of wetness ingress or paint flaking, which might need localized sanding and repainting to avoid rot.
Track and Channel Cleaning
For horizontal or vertical moving systems, the tracks are typically the most disregarded location. Dirt and grit can develop in the channels, triggering the sliders to stick or jump. Using a vacuum cleaner with a narrow nozzle attachment is the most reliable method to get rid of particles. Following a vacuum, the tracks must be cleaned with a moist cloth to eliminate any remaining great dust.
Lubrication and Hardware Care
Moving parts go through friction. Without appropriate lubrication, hinges can squeak, and sliders can end up being tough to run.
- Sliders: Once the tracks are tidy, a light application of a silicone-based spray is recommended. Prevent oil-based lubes like WD-40 for the tracks, as these can draw in more dust and turn into a sticky paste gradually.
- Hinges and Pivots: For hinged systems, a drop of light-weight device oil (like 3-in-1 oil) on the pivot points as soon as a year will maintain smooth movement.
- Locks and Catches: Ensure that catches engage fully. If a lock feels stiff, a small quantity of graphite powder or silicone spray can be applied to the mechanism.
Managing Seals and Gaskets
The effectiveness of secondary glazing relies almost completely on its seals. If the seals stop working, the "dead air" area in between the primary and secondary window is compromised, causing heat loss and noise leakage.
Brush Seals
Many sliding secondary glazing utilizes brush piles (strips of great bristles) to produce a seal while permitting motion. These ought to be examined for flattening or balding. If the brushes are obstructed with dust, they can be gently brushed out with a soft toothbrush.
Rubber Gaskets
In "lift-out" or hinged systems, rubber or EPDM gaskets are more typical. Over years of direct exposure to sunlight and temperature level changes, these can become breakable or shrink. Using a specialized rubber conditioner once a year can help preserve versatility. If a gasket is split, it must be changed instantly to keep the thermal envelope.
Upkeep Schedule and Checklist
To simplify the maintenance process, the following table details a recommended maintenance frequency for common Secondary Glazing Styles glazing installations.
Table 1: Secondary Glazing Maintenance Schedule
| Task | Frequency | Function |
|---|---|---|
| Clean Glass Surfaces | Every 2-- 3 Months | Preserve clarity and aesthetics. |
| Wipe Down Frames | Every 6 Months | Get rid of pollutants and prevent surface degradation. |
| Vacuum Slideways/Tracks | Every 6 Months | Prevent sticking and mechanical wear. |
| Check Brush/Rubber Seals | Yearly | Guarantee airtightness and acoustic efficiency. |
| Lube Moving Parts | Yearly | Guarantee smooth operation and avoid hardware failure. |
| Inspect Perimeter Sealant | Annually | Examine for spaces where the system satisfies the reveal. |
Repairing Common Issues
Even with routine cleaning, periodic issues might develop. Understanding how to diagnose these problems is the primary step toward an option.
Table 2: Common Problems and Solutions
| Issue | Likely Cause | Recommended Action |
|---|---|---|
| Condensation between panes | Poor seal or high humidity in the cavity. | Guarantee main window is sealed; check Secondary Glazing Installers seals. |
| Rattling in the wind | Loose catches or used brush seals. | Tighten hardware or replace brush piles. |
| Sash is difficult to move | Debris in tracks or lack of lubrication. | Vacuum tracks and apply silicone spray. |
| Whistling sound | Air getting away through a little gap in a seal. | Identify the gap and change the corresponding seal area. |
| Glass feels cold/drafty | System is not seated correctly in the frame. | Make sure the sash is totally closed or "lift-out" is flush. |
Addressing Condensation
Among the most frequent worry about Secondary Glazing Aluminium Options glazing is condensation forming in between the original window and the brand-new secondary pane. While secondary glazing is designed to stop drafts, the cavity in between the 2 windows should be handled correctly.
If condensation takes place, it usually indicates that moist air from the space is dripping into the cavity, or that the primary (external) window is so dripping that cold air is cooling the cavity too quickly.
- Suggestion: Ensure the secondary glazing is fitted with a reliable airtight seal on the room side.
- Tip: If the issue continues, using little packets of desiccant (silica gel) concealed in the frame can absorb recurring wetness.
- Idea: Ensure that the main window is as draught-proof as possible from the exterior.
Best Practices for Long-Term Care
To make sure the system lasts for decades, owners should follow these "dos and do n'ts":
- Do use two hands when running big moving or hinged systems to ensure balanced pressure on the frames.
- Do inspect the outside masonry and main window annual. If the external window fails, the secondary window will be required to work harder, resulting in much faster wear.
- Do keep the space well-ventilated. Secondary Glazing Maintenance Tips (doc.adminforge.De) glazing makes a room extremely airtight, which can cause greater internal humidity if not handled.
- Do not use pressure washers or garden hoses to tidy secondary glazing; it is internal joinery and not developed for high-pressure water.
- Don't lean heavy objects versus the glass or frames.
- Don't paint over the rubber seals or brush piles, as this will damage their capability to compress and seal.

Regularly Asked Questions (FAQ)
Q: Can I get rid of the secondary glazing panels for cleaning?A: Yes, a lot of systems are created for this. Moving systems can typically be lifted up and out of the track (check your manufacturer's handbook), and "lift-out" systems are particularly developed to be eliminated completely for access to the main window.
Q: What is the very best lubricant for moving windows?A: A dry silicone spray is the finest choice. It offers lubrication without the oily residue that attracts dirt and hair, which would otherwise block the tracks.
Q: Why is there a gap at the bottom of my secondary glazing?A: Some installers leave a tiny, intentional "weep" gap or use a breathable seal if the primary window is susceptible to extreme wetness. This allows the cavity to "breathe" a little, preventing fogging between the panes. Consult your installer before sealing any deliberate gaps.
Q: How do I understand if my seals need replacing?A: If you see a sudden boost in outdoors sound or feel an unique draft coming from the edges of the frame even when closed, it is time to check the seals for compression or damage.
Q: Is it safe to utilize vinegar on secondary glazing?A: While vinegar is a popular natural glass cleaner, it is acidic. If it drips onto aluminum frames or rubber gaskets, it can trigger deterioration or drying over time. If utilized, it ought to be watered down heavily and wiped away instantly.
